About Douglas College
Douglas College is a major community college with two campuses in Greater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ada. It serves 9000 credit students each year and offers two-year career, University Transfer and Applied Degree Programs to local, national and international students.

About Royals Athletics
Douglas College is internationally renowned for it's excellence in athletic development and achievement. As a participating member in the Canadian College Athletic Association, Douglas College has eight intercollegiate sports for Men and Women in six athletic associations/confederation both in Canada and the United States. 

British Columbia College Athletic Association (BCCAA) Teams
Badminton, Basketball, Soccer and Volleyball 

Northwest Athletic Association of Community Colleges (NWAACC is based in Vancouver, WA)
Baseball, Cross Country, Golf

Westcoast Women's Rugby Association (WCWRA)
Women's Rugby

Fraser Valley Rugby Union
Men's Rugby

National Collegiate Wrestling Association (NCWA is based in Dallas,TX)
Wrestling

Facilities
Our 20 National Championships and 37 Provincial Championships are contributed from one of the best athletic facilities in the country. 

  • Full service gymnasiums (New Westminster and Coquitlam campuses)

  • 'State of Art' fitness training centres equipped with free weights, weight machines and Cardio machines.

  • Therapy Room with access to on-site massage therapy and rehabilitation services.

  • Athletic lounge

  • Mundy Park

If you are interested in competing in intercollegiate athletics for Douglas College, please complete the Prospective Athlete Form and submit it to the athletic program in which you are interested in participating. This form is NOT an official college application. 

ATTENTION:If you participated in any athletic program at a post secondary institution(s) in the preceding year, BCCAA rules and regulations strictly prohibit us from having any communication with you, directly or indirectly, until that institution grants our institution permission to contact you.
